What channel is Monday Night Football on?

In the US, you’ll find Monday Night Football is broadcast on ABC and ESPN. In some weeks, you’ll also be able to catch the game on ESPN+. In the UK, you’ll find Monday Night Football is shown on Channel 5 each week, free of charge on broadcast TV or streamed online.  

Where to watch Monday Night Football in the US

Most cable and satellite services in the US include ESPN, and you can also stream the network via the web using your provider’s credentials. If you don’t subscribe to a pay-TV cable provider, you can also watch Monday Night Football via a live TV streaming service. Where to watch Monday Night Football in the UK

Channel 5 in the United Kingdom shows Monday Night Football for free. Viewers can live stream the games if they make a free account on the Channel 5 website.
